Following my Reclast infusion I contemplated not doing it again. I felt awful and kept a diary of my experience. I did post that in this forum. Maybe you can search by my name.

Anyway, the point is that by week four I was feeling back to normal. Now that I know what I'm in for ; > I will repeat the treatment in February. I'm told the side effects should lessen after the first time. Also, I will take Aleve and claritan and hydrate before and after as a few ladies have suggested.
Perhaps someone on this forum can tell us if the side effects lessen with the second Reclast treatment??

My side effects were zero after my second Reclast last October! Bad 2 weeks after first but I insisted doctor order 45 min drip and I took pre infusion Tylenol for 2 days prior. I was shocked at the minimal problems after some bad ones the first infusion!
